Josh Eidelson: The influx of people who want to solve reflects the allure of the labor movement. It also reflects the desperation of labor organizers in the US and their sense that the deck is stacked against them, he says. Eidelson: Companies that fought unsuccessfully in many cases to prevent people from choosing to unionize may not easily agree to any kind of contract they would accept.
